About 1-[(1R)-1-chloroethyl]sulfonylbutane
1-[(1R)-1-chloroethyl]sulfonylbutane (PubChem CID 94036808) has the molecular formula C6H13ClO2S
and a molecular weight of 184.69 g/mol. Its IUPAC name is 1-[(1R)-1-chloroethyl]sulfonylbutane.
